Rear lift gate would not unlock via remote or manual key. From the interior, there is no manual override or emergency release to manually open the lift gate door or window. In the event of an accident, escaping from a vehicle that was damaged, overturned or on fire via the rear door would not be possible due to the lack of an emergency rear lift gate release. In my case, I had secured my pet in a pet crate in the rear of the vehicle on a 77 degree day. I could not get him out the rear access, unable to open same by any means. Fortunately I had time and crawled in the back, turned the crate around, folded down rear seats, and removed 100 lb labrador retriever out the second row door. There is a keyed lock blow the lift gate in the rear covered by a plastic door. The key turned and the whole lock cylinder came out. There is no information on this lock in the driver's manual of what it does or does not do. I am having this repaired immediately at my expense. I feel this is a serious safety issue that needs to be addressed by Chevrolet/gm. I was lucky because it was not a life or death situation.
